Key Fob Key fobs are small device that has buttons that control your Volkswagen vehicle's doors and locks. These devices offer superior convenience compared to traditional metal keys, but they need a bit more maintenance. If you find that your VW key fob doesn't function as well as it used to, it may be time to replace the batteries. This is a simple procedure that can be done at home using just a few supplies. You'll require an phillips screwdriver with a flat head, and a brand new CR2032 cell. Wrapping the screwdriver with tape will keep it from scratching the case of your fob. Find the seam that connects the lid to the base of the VW keyfob. Carefully pry apart the two pieces using your screwdriver, taking care not to scratch any of them. Insert the new battery making sure the positive side faces downward. Close the remote tightly and then put it back together. Contact us or schedule an appointment online if the key fob doesn't work. It has set tumbler and a pin that is aligned with the cuts in your key to unlock or secure the cylinder. It also has springs that allow you to reset them after use. If your key is not working or is locked, it could be time to replace the cylinder of your key. You might observe that the cylinder is difficult to turn or that you must move it around to get it working. These signs could indicate that the pins or tumblers inside the cylinder for the key have worn out or broken. A locksmith can come to you and change your key cylinder, making sure that it works like the original one did.
